“Vodafone Introduces Scam Call Protection Amid Rising Phone Scams”

Date:

Dealing with unwanted phone calls has become a common challenge for smartphone users. Recent data reveals that on average, consumers in the UK are bombarded with eight such calls every month. These calls often aim to extract personal information and credit card details for malicious purposes.

To combat this issue and enhance user safety, Vodafone has introduced a new feature called Scam Call Protection. This innovative service leverages artificial intelligence (AI) to detect and alert users about potentially fraudulent, spam, scam, or nuisance calls.

Scam Call Protection operates discreetly in the background, analyzing all incoming calls to users’ phones. When it identifies suspicious activity, customers receive a simple on-screen notification indicating a possible scam call.

According to Rob Winterschladen, Consumer Director at Vodafone, detecting scam calls has become increasingly challenging, leaving individuals vulnerable. He emphasized that the Scam Call Protection feature on Vodafone Secure Net Mobile offers an additional layer of security by constantly monitoring calls and flagging potential scam calls, reinforcing their commitment to digital security.

The Scam Call Protection enhancement is integrated into Vodafone’s Secure Net Mobile platform, which already includes advanced parental controls, continuous ID monitoring to prevent identity theft, and real-time virus and malware protection.

Customers can experience the Scam Call Protection service free of charge for three months as a trial. Subsequently, the service is available for £2 per month.
